On July 21, 2011 we are seeing the 10 year treasury rate yield around 2.95% which is very close to 2011 lows. The 10 year treasury rate yield in the 30 year fixed mortgage of had a very strong correlation since 1971 to it should come as no surprise to see 10 year treasury rate yields pushing the overall direction of interest rates.

Before borrowing money through a credit card is always a wise decision to completely understand the terms and agreements. By reading all of the small print and completely understanding how this money will be paid back it will likely be true that individuals have a much better chance at building a strong credit history.

Unfortunately, many Americans go into the credit card process believing that they will come up with the money to play this card off. It would be a wise choice to create a strong weekly or monthly budget and make 100% certain that money will be readily available when a credit card payment is due. Rather than holding high balance on a credit card is always a wise choice to pay down as much as possible.
